Driver should be enabled by CONFIG_POWER_DOMAIN=y and CONFIG_ZYNQMP_POWER_DOMAIN=y. Power domain driver doesn't have own DT node but it uses zynqmp firmware DT node that's why there is a need to bind driver when firmware node is found. Driver itself is simple. It is sending pmufw config object overlay for enabling access to device which is done in ...domain_request(). In ...domain_on() capabilities are passed and node is requested. This should be bare minimum of required to get power domain driver working.
